Post by iphonechik » November 28th, 2010, 12:23 pm

Prior to the upgrade, the switch used to control the Orientation. Now, it mutes the iPad. The Orientation is now controlled by double clicking the home button like the iPhone and choosing to lock or unlock.

Post by wcassing » December 1st, 2010, 6:10 am

There is a problem I syncing iCal via Mobile Me. If you installed the interim beta e-mail solution:
1. Backup your calendar,
2. Completely delete the interim beta e-mail account from your iPad, and
3. Resync via Mobile Me.
NOTE: Ignore this if you sync your calendar via iTunes!,,

Post by mark_42 » December 7th, 2010, 8:56 pm

Gushin, I had the same problem with my iPhone 3GS. The thing is that I believe that's an intermittent bug in iTunes since it has happened to me a total of three times since 2007, spanning two different phones and two different computers. When I updated to 4.2.1 I had no problems with my iPad but my iPhone "lost touch" with the internal media library. The files were still there but the iPod app just didn't see them. I just reset my settings and let it sync again. I've reported this to Apple but since it isn't a reproducible problem there isn't much they can do about it.
